The 2006 Rogue Trooper game received positive praise from reviewers and was nominated for UK BAFTA awards. It's imaginative stuff, sci-fi future war certainly engaging the youth of the 1980s with Star Wars itself still only a recent phenomenon. If a GI dies, their biochip can be extracted and placed into an equipment slot allowing the deceased GI's enduring personality to communicate with the player and control your gun, backpack or helmet. Rogue is not completely alone all GIs have a biochip embedded inside their skull which contains their consciousness, memories and personality traits. The game follows his path in this mission seeking to avenge his fallen comrades. The GIs are almost entirely massacred except for our protagonist, Rogue, who goes AWOL in pursuit of the traitor general. As the game begins the GIs are deployed to Nu-Earth but the Nort forces are expecting them, the information relayed from a Souther traitor general. Through genetic engineering, the Southers created a new soldier, the Genetic Infantryman (GI), who is immune to the toxic atmosphere of Nu-Earth. Ravaged by chemical and biological weapons, the planet has been poisoned and forces on either side must wear protective equipment and live in specially enclosed cities. Rogue Trooper tells the story of a future war between the Norts and Southers over the strategic planet Nu-Earth. While Dredd is undoubtedly the most recognisable 2000AD character, in my view the better game came in the form of Rogue Trooper in 2006, released for PC, PlayStation 2 and Xbox – the original Xbox, then for Wii in 2009. The big budget 1995 Judge Dredd film featuring Sylvester Stallone was widely panned, although the lower-budget Karl Urban 2012 Dredd movie was well received and fans hope to see a TV series materialise. The comic has enjoyed longevity the editors never imagined, well surpassing the year it is named after, which seemed so far off when issue one hit newsagents in 1977.ĭespite its print success, and despite the rich variety of content, 2000AD's characters haven't enjoyed huge success in other media. This is the publication which introduced the world to the iconic future lawman, Judge Dredd, among other cult classics. For those unfamiliar, Rogue Trooper has been entertaining readers of long-lasting British sci-fi comic 2000AD for more thanb 35 years, first appearing in print in 1981.
